Before the MCU changed Hollywood, Marvel was already making millions—just not from movies.

In the 1990s and early 2000s, Marvel’s survival depended on licensing its characters. Spider-Man, X-Men, and other heroes were rented out to studios and companies to sell merchandise, toys, and games long before Marvel Studios existed.
